Sequoia: "The Next $1T Company Sells Work, Not Software"

Sequoia Capital — the firm that backed Apple, Google, Nvidia, YouTube, Airbnb, Stripe — dropped a thesis worth reading closely.
The old model: For 20+ years, tech sold software. Microsoft sells Office, Adobe sells Photoshop, Salesforce sells CRM. Tools that help humans work faster. Copilot for everything.
The problem: Customers don't want software. They want work done. You don't want accounting software — you want books closed on time, taxes filed, reports delivered.
The insight: For every $1 businesses spend on software, they spend $6 on services. SaaS has been fighting over that $1. AI can now digitize the $6 — the knowledge workforce itself.
The map: Sequoia's Opportunity Map plots work by Intelligence vs. Judgement, Outsourced vs. Insourced. The sweet spot: highly standardized, already outsourced workflows — Insurance Brokerage ($140-200B), Accounting ($50-80B), Healthcare Revenue Cycle ($50-80B).
2025 = Copilot. 2026 = Autopilot. The winners won't build AI tools for accountants — they'll build AI accounting firms. Sequoia warns most Copilot startups face the Innovator's Dilemma: today you sell software to accountants, tomorrow you'd compete with them.
The bottom line: The next $1T AI company won't have the smartest chatbot. It'll be the first to turn work into a service you buy like electricity.

🛑Tectonic hit by a Mango-style $75M pump-and-borrow

Cronos paused its entire blockchain on Sunday after an exploit hit Tectonic , its largest lending protocol — with an estimated $75M affected and no restart timeline announced.

How it went down:
🔍 Onchain researcher Weilin Li reconstructed the attack: the hacker exploited TONIC's 20% collateral factor and thin liquidity , pumping the token ~ 100x within 20 minutes , then used the inflated collateral to borrow ~$75M in real assets — a classic "Mango-market style" pump-and-borrow

💸 Per @lookonchain: the attacker bridged $6.29M to Ethereum (swapped into 2,592 ETH) before the halt — the other ~$68.7M is stranded on Cronos , frozen by validators

🛡️ Crypto.com CEO Kris Marszalek confirmed the breach but said the app and exchange were unaffected and all funds there are safe, with the security team assisting Tectonic

📉 Per DefiLlama, Tectonic's TVL sat at ~$121.7M (with ~$82.7M active loans) before the attack — it has since collapsed to roughly $3M as the drained positions unwound

Neither Cronos nor Tectonic has confirmed the root cause or the final loss figure, and there's no word yet on address blacklisting, recovery, or user compensation — Tectonic simply advised users not to interact with the protocol while it investigates.

#ukreleasesfirstcryptogainstaxstats — HMRC finally shows its hand

The UK tax office published its first-ever official statistics on crypto capital gains , and the headline number is doing the rounds: 240 people each declared over £1 million in crypto gains in the 2024–25 tax year.

The full picture from the
17,600 individuals reported taxable crypto gains of £1.38 billion (~$1.87B) on £13.8 billion of disposal proceeds — an average of ~ £78,000 per filer

The 240 crypto millionaires alone accounted for £717 million — more than half of all gains65% of filers had gains under £25,000, contributing just 7% of the total — a heavy-tail market

Demographics: 87% male , 54% aged 25–44, 81% under 54

This was also the first year HMRC added a dedicated crypto section to Self Assessment returns, rather than folding it into general CGT

The enforcement side is accelerating: HMRC sent 81,000 crypto tax "nudge" letters over the past year — up 25% from ~65,000 and nearly triple the 27,714 in 2023–24. Financial Secretary James Murray was blunt: "taxes are due on cryptoasset gains just like any other gains".

What's coming:
OECD CARF data exchange : UK began implementing in Jan 2026; from May 31, 2027 , HMRC will auto-receive UK-resident customer data from exchanges across 52 jurisdictions , +15 more in 2028 — "paired with basic AI tools, catching underreporting becomes straightforward" per UHY Hacker Young partner Neela Chauhan

DeFi reprieve : from April 6, 2027 , lending and liquidity-pool transactions get CGT deferred until economic disposal — affecting ~700,000 people

HMRC estimates its compliance push already raised an extra £168M in CGT for 2024–25, projecting £315M by 2030

#about67mamericansholdcrypto — the mainstream stat just got political

The number doing the rounds in DC: 67 million Americans now hold crypto — roughly 1 in 4 US adults. It comes from the National Crypto Association's 2026 State of Crypto Holders Report, which also counts 232,000 US jobs backed by the industry.

Why it matters now: Ripple CEO Brad Garlinghouse pushed the stat at the White House last week alongside Trump, SEC Chair Atkins and CFTC Chair Selig — framing crypto as "voters, consumers and an economic force Washington cannot ignore". It's the messaging engine behind the CLARITY Act , which already passed the House with 78 Democrats joining every Republican and now heads to the Senate.

The counter-signal: a NIRS survey shows 77% of Americans still call crypto in retirement plans risky — so Washington is moving faster than the public's comfort level.

Bottom line: 67M holders turned crypto from niche into a voting bloc — that's why the clarity push has bipartisan legs. Adoption is here; trust is still catching up.

#usstrikesiranianrocketlaunchers — tit-for-tat is live

The US hit two Iranian launchers on Larak Island (Strait of Hormuz) — the first openly acknowledged US strike on Iran since late July. CENTCOM said the launchers were being readied to lay sea mines in the strait.

Iran answered within hours: ballistic missiles fired at US bases in Jordan (Muwaffaq Salti & King Hussein air bases). Jordan said 8 missiles were intercepted ; a US source says nearly all were stopped with no significant impacts.

Notable: Tehran hit a US base in a neighboring Arab state, not shipping in the strait — but the IRGC vows Larak "will definitely be punished," and Trump claims the US now has "almost complete control" of Hormuz after clearing mines.

Market: Brent > $90 (+2.3%), WTI gap-up ~2%; BTC -1.7% ~$77.4K; gold gap-down; Asia equities softer.

Bottom line: the first direct US–Iran exchange in a month — contained so far (missiles intercepted, strait untouched), but the "punishment" threat leaves a live escalation premium in oil. Next headline decides direction.
